Museum Kids Factory runs through 14 August at the Philips Museum for ages 6–12; each ninety-minute start has only five child places and costs a museum ticket plus €4.

What you need to know

Technology here is not pressing one display button. Six- and seven-year-olds work with materials and glue guns, while children from eight can explore simple electronics, soldering, sawing and drilling, helped by volunteers to make a light or object move. The small group gives tools and questions time. Adults do not book a Factory place but need museum admission and remain responsible. Age boundaries protect tool safety, not status. Scarcity also should not tempt an adult to complete the project for the child. Hokimi suggests arriving with one problem—make a lamp flash, a vehicle move or a structure stand. That turns a pretty object into a first engineering argument.



  • This run is 8–14 August.
  • The workshop is for ages 6–12 and lasts about 1.5 hours.
  • Only five children are accepted per start time.
  • A child pays museum entry plus €4; adults need entry only.
